Abstract :
In this paper, a new deniable signature scheme, i.e. the committal deniable signature scheme is proposed. This scheme has been constructed by use of bilinear pairings over elliptic curves. In addition to the general property possessed by other deniable signature schemes, there are some new features for this new scheme. One important of them is that signer is not able to forge this type of deniable signatures on behalf of the verifier or any third party. Another feature is that any third party, even though she can obtain the committal deniable signatures by tapping, cannot distinguish the actual signer between the verifier and the signer in the underlying system.
